- The distance between Adrar, Algeria and Los Andes, El Salvador is approximately 9,240 km or 5,742 mi.
- To reach Adrar in this distance one would set out from Los Andes bearing 62.9°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Adrar bearing 102.1° or ESE .
- Adrar has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Los Andes has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
- Adrar is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Los Andes is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 9.2 °C (16.6°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.4 °C (36.7°F) more in Adrar.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 2259.4 mm (89 in) less which is equivalent to 2259.4 l/m² (55.45 US gal/ft²) or 22,594,000 l/ha (2,415,449 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10.1° lower in Adrar than in Los Andes.
